Abstract

A receiver circuit including an oscillator, a mixer coupled to the oscillator, a switch coupled to an output of the mixer, and an envelope detector coupled to the oscillator, such that the envelope detector generates a timing signal for actuating the switch based on the envelope of a signal produced by the oscillator. In one exemplary embodiment, the receiver circuit may be used as part of a radar based sensor system.

Claims (31)

1. A circuit comprising:

an oscillator;

a mixer coupled to the oscillator;

a switch coupled to an output of the mixer; and,

an envelope detector coupled to the oscillator,

wherein an envelope detector generates a timing signal for actuating the switch based on the envelope of a signal produced by the oscillator.

2. The circuit of claim 1 , further comprising:

an amplifier coupled between the mixer and the switch.

3. The circuit of claim 1 , wherein the timing signal oscillates between a first state and a second state.

4. The circuit of claim 3 , wherein the first state corresponds to an oscillating signal produced by the oscillator, and the second state corresponds to a non-oscillating signal produced by the oscillator.

5. The circuit of claim 3 , wherein said first state corresponds to a first voltage value and said second state corresponds to a second voltage value.

6. A receiver comprising:

an antenna capable of receiving at least one reflected signal from an object;

an oscillator;

a mixer coupled to the oscillator, said mixer operating on said at least one reflected signal and a signal produced by said oscillator;

a switch coupled to an output of the mixer; and,

an envelope detector coupled to the oscillator,

wherein the envelope detector generates a timing signal for actuating the switch based on the envelope of a signal produced by the oscillator.

7. The receiver of claim 6 , wherein the timing signal oscillates between a first state and a second state.

8. A sensor system comprising:

a transmitter for transmitting at least one pulse towards an object; and

a receiver for receiving at least one pulse reflected off of the object, said receiver comprising:

an oscillator;

a mixer coupled to the oscillator;

a first switch coupled to an output of the mixer; and,

an envelope detector coupled to the oscillator,

wherein the envelope detector generates a timing signal for actuating the switch based on the envelope of a signal produced by the oscillator.

9. The sensor system of claim 8 , further comprising a second switch for selecting one of either the transmitter or receiver.

10. The sensor system of claim 8 , further comprising a sample and hold circuit coupled to the output of the first switch.

11. The sensor system of claim 8 , further comprising at least one antenna coupled to the transmitter for transmitting a signal towards an object.

12. The sensor system of claim 8 , wherein the timing signal oscillates between a first state and a second state.
